What is Double Glazing?
Double glazing refers to a window construction that incorporates 2 panes of glass separated by an area filled with a gas (normally argon) or a vacuum. This design provides improved insulation compared to single-pane windows, significantly reducing heat loss and external sound penetration.

Choosing the Right Double Glazing for Your Home
When selecting double glazing, several aspects should be thought about. Experts advise focusing on the following:
Frame Material:
- uPVC: Low maintenance and outstanding thermal performance.
- Aluminum: Sleek and modern but less insulating unless thermal breaks are integrated.
- Wood: Aesthetic appeal with excellent insulation but needs more maintenance.
Glazing Type:
- Low-E Glass: Coated to show heat back into the space.
- Obscured Glass: Provides personal privacy while still enabling light.
- Self-Cleaning Glass: Uses an unique coating to break down dirt and grime.
Gas Fill:
- Argon Gas: Commonly used for its insulating residential or commercial properties.
- Krypton Gas: More efficient than argon but also more costly.
Spacing Bars:
- Warm Edge Spacers: Improve thermal performance compared to traditional aluminum spacers.

Maintenance Tips for Double Glazing
To maintain the benefits of double glazing, regular maintenance is key. Here are some professional ideas:
- Clean the Glass: Regularly clean both the interior and exterior glass surface areas.
- Check Seals: Check the seals around the window frames for any signs of wear or damage.
- Clear Drains: Keep drain holes clear of debris to avoid water accumulation.
- Examine for Condensation: If condensation appears in between panes, you may require to change the system.
Often Asked Questions (FAQ)
1. For how long does double glazing last?
Answer: Properly set up and maintained double glazing can last over 20 years.

3. Can I replace just one pane of double glazing?
Response: It is frequently affordable to replace the whole unit instead of just one pane, especially if the seals are harmed.
4. How much energy can double glazing conserve?
Response: Double glazing can save property owners in between 10-25% on their energy costs, depending upon the kind of heating unit and local climate.
5. What is the typical cost of double glazing installation?
Answer: Costs differ extensively based on materials, size, and installation intricacy. On average, property owners can expect to pay in between ₤ 800 to ₤ 1,500 per window.
